Linux下模拟http的get/post请求(curl or wget)详解
Linux下模拟http的get/post请求(curl or wget)详解
背景
最近项目中需要测试接口,但是测试服务器通过堡垒机才能访问,暂时又没有通过Nginx进行转发,只好直接在Linux上模拟http请求进行测试。
方法
get请求
curl “http://www.baidu.com” 如果URL指向的是一个文件或者一幅图可以直接下载到本地
curl -i ...
详解Ubuntu/CentOS下Apache多站点配置
前言:
情景一:平时在我们开发的时候,一般项目都只存放在 localhost 指定的根目录下,当有好几个项目的时候,只能在根目录下以不同的文件夹区分,特别的不方便。
情景二:平时在看教学视频的时候,总是看到那些老师在单机下使用不同的域名,访问的却是本地的项目代码,每当这时候我都会问, ...
Centos6.5搭建java开发环境配置详解
一、安装jdk
1.查看Linux自带的JDK是否已安装?
1java –version
如果出现openjdk,最好还是先卸载掉openjdk,在安装sun公司的jdk.
2.查看jdk信息?
1rpm -qa|grep java
3.卸载OpenJDK,执行以下操作:?
1
2rpm -e --nodeps tzdata-java-2012c-1.el6.noarch rpm -e --nodeps java-1.7.0-o ...
详解CentOS安装tomcat并且部署Java Web项目
1.准备工作
a.下载tomcat linux的包,地址:http://tomcat.apache.org/download-80.cgi,,我们下载的版本是8.0,下载方式如图:
b.因为tomcat的安装依赖于java jdk,所以我们需要在判断linux系统下面是否安装jdk
b.1 使用(xshell)连接到linux系统下面
b.2 输入 ...
CentOS 7.2 安装MariaDB详细过程
mariadb简介
mariadb数据库管理系统是mysql的一个分支,主要由开源社区在维护,采用gpl授权许可 mariadb的目的是完全兼容mysql,包括api和命令行,使之能轻松成为mysql的代替品。在存储引擎方面,使用xtradb(英语:xtradb)来代替mysql的innodb。 mariadb由mysql的创始人michael widenius(英语:michael widenius)主 ...
CentOS 7.2部署邮件服务器(Postfix)
一、Postfix简介
Postfix 是一种电子邮件服务器,它是由任职于IBM华生研究中心(T.J. Watson Research Center)的荷兰籍研究员Wietse Venema为了改良sendmail邮件服务器而产生的。最早在1990年代晚期出现,是一个开放源代码的软件。
Postfix 官方网站:http://www.postfix.org/
Postfix 下载地址:http://www.postfix.or ...
Ubuntu17.04开放下载:支持AMD Ryzen和Intel Kaby Lake处理器
Canonical公司今天正式开放了Ubuntu 17.04版本操作系统的下载,新版系统代号Zesty Zapus。
Ubuntu 17.04并非长期支持版本(LTS),因此它的生命周期仅仅只有9个月。
值得注意的是,Ubuntu 17.04响应了此前Canonical公布的新战略,将默认系统界面调整为熟悉的GNOME,而Unity界面将作为备选项。而等到Ubuntu 18.04 LTS ...
centos7 + php7 lamp全套最新版本配置及mongodb和redis教程详解
所有软件的版本一直会升级,注意自己当时的版本是不是已经更新了。首先装centos7
装好centos7后默认是不能上网的?
1cd /etc/sysconfig/network-scripts/
找到形如ifcfg-enp0s3的文件,修改onboot=yes
然后?
1service network restart
安装apache2 (centos里叫httpd)?
1yum install httpd
启 ...
Centos6.5 ssh配置与使用教程
下面给大家介绍centos6.5 ssh配置与使用教程的知识,具体详情如下所示:?123456789101112#rpm -qa |grep ssh 检查是否装了ssh包#yum install openssh-server 没有的话,安装ssh服务#chkconfig --list sshd 检查sshd是否在本运行级别下设置为开机启动#chkconfig --level 2345 sshd on 如果没设置启动就设置下 ...
ubuntu系统怎么更新? ubuntu升级系统的两种方式
用ubuntu那么久有点问题总想着能不能更新下解决,那么ubuntu怎么做系统更新呢?我们通常使用这两种方式。
1、首先我们ctrl+alt+t打开终端。
2、更新ubuntu系统的apt资源。
$sudo apt-get update
3、进行ubuntu系统与软件更新。
$sudo apt-get upgrade
4、还有一种方式,就是我们也可以在 ...
Linux中对MySQL优化实例详解
Linux中对MySQL优化实例详解
vim /etc/my.cnf以下只列出my.cnf文件中[mysqld]段落中的内容,其他段落内容对MySQL运行性能影响甚微,因而姑且忽略。
?
1
2
3
4
5
[mysql ...
Centos 6和Centos 7下服务启动方法及添加到开机启动项的方法
在linux系统中,安装完一个软件或应用后,有时候需要手动启动该应用,也需要收到将该应用添加到开机启动项中,让其可以能够在linux一开机后就加载该应用
启动应用的方法
CentOS 6 :
service SERVICE start|stop|restart|reload|status
CentOS 7 :
systemctl start|stop|restart|reload|status SERVICE
添加到 ...
centos6.5中用yum方式安装php5.4与apache2.2的步骤
前言
centos6.5系统,yum install php默认的版本是php5.3,本次安装需要最低版本为php5.4,最开始用yum install httpd安装了apache2.2,但是源码编译php5.5的时候,configure参数始终找不到apache的apxs2文件,编译失败。
网上找到一个镜像,rpm下载后,安装包整合了apache2.2,php5.4.45,直接yum install就可以安装 ...
CentOS平台实现搭建rsync远程同步服务器的方法
本文实例讲述了CentOS平台实现搭建rsync远程同步服务器的方法。分享给大家供大家参考,具体如下:
rsync(remote synchronize)是一个远程数据同步工具,可通过LAN/WAN快速同步多台主机间的文件,也可以使用 rsync 同步本地硬盘中的不同目录。rsync和scp的区别:
rsync支持增量同步,不管是文件数量的新增还是文件内容 ...
CentOS7使用dnf安装mysql的方法
本文介绍了CentOS7使用dnf安装mysql的方法,分享给大家,具体如下:
1.安装mysql的yum仓库
执行以下命令:
复制代码 代码如下:
yum localinstall https://dev.mysql.com/get/mysql57-community-release-el7-11.noarch.rpm
2.安装mysql?
1dnf install mysql-community-server
3.开启mysql服务?
...
Centos7的apache网站环境搭建wordpress
需要安装apache,php,mariadb
安装Apache
yum install -y httpd
apache启动并设置开机自启
systemctl start httpd.service
systemctl enable httpd.service
安装PHP及其各项服务
yum -y install php php-gd php-ldap php-odbc php-pear php-xml php-xmlrpc php-mbstring php-snmp php-soap c ...
详解Xampp和wordpress在Centos7上的搭建与使用
xampp下载地址
注意:并不是xampp版本越高越好,找到与之对应的PHP版本选择下载
wordpress下载地址
注意:下载tar.gz包
安装xampp,把xampp文件权限给满,以防权限不够安装失败
chmod -R 777 xampp-linux-x64-5.6.30-1-installer.run
./xampp-linux-x64-5.6.30-1-installer.run
注意:如linux ...
浅析Centos7搭建samba服务器方法
samba服务器类似于windows上的文件共享,通过//ip地址访问文件
配置ip地址
实现内网互通,互ping ip地址安装samba服务器?
1yum install -y samba
注意:这条命令是centos的,Redhat的安装samba服务器在下面创建文件管理用户?
1useradd vina设置vina为Samba的登录用户?
1pdbedit -a -u v ...
Centos7实现磁盘限额设置方法
添加硬盘到虚拟机 并实现自动挂载
完成挂载硬盘后,开始以下步骤
注意:需要在配置文件/etc/fstab,defaults 后面那加上usrquota和grpquota “,”隔开
如:?
1/dev/sdb1 /mnt/daobin ext4 defaults,usrquota,grpquota 0 0mount命令先挂载上去?
1mount /dev/sdb1 /mnt/daobin?
1mount - ...
Linux中Centos7搭建Hadoop服务步骤
下载Hadoop 官网:http://hadoop.apache.org/releases.html
先配置jdk环境
下载以后 解压到到/usr/local?
1tar -zxvf hadoop-2.8.0.tar.gz -c /usr/local
为了方便操作 把hadoop-2.8.0 改为hadoop?
1mv /usr/local/hadoop-2.8.0 /usr/local/hadoop
查看主机名?
1hostname //第一个参数为主机 ...